Original 1892 Framingham Academy Centennial Wax Seal produced to commemorate the 100th anniversary of the academy's 1792 founding, the seal features the "common seal" design originally donated to the school in 1799 by Captain Jonathan Maynard—a Revolutionary War hero and the town's first postmaster.
The artifact captures the intricate heraldic imagery of one of the region's earliest institutions of higher learning. As an authentic 19th-century commemorative, it serves as a superb document of New England educational heritage and localized centennial celebrations.
